Understanding Your Hearing Loss
If you’ve noticed that conversations seem muffled or you frequently ask people to repeat themselves, you may be experiencing hearing loss. It’s essential to understand the potential causes and implications of this condition. Hearing loss can result from various factors such as aging, exposure to loud noises, genetics, or certain medical conditions. By recognizing the signs early on, you can take proactive steps to address your hearing health.
Hearing loss can impact various aspects of your life, including communication, relationships, and overall well-being. Struggling to hear can lead to feelings of isolation, frustration, and even embarrassment in social situations.
It’s important to seek professional help if you suspect you have hearing loss. A hearing test conducted by an audiologist can accurately assess your hearing abilities and determine the most suitable course of action.
Types of Affordable Hearing Aids
You may have recognized the signs of hearing loss and are now considering options for affordable hearing aids. When looking for the best solution, it’s essential to understand the different types of affordable hearing aids available.
- In-the-ear (ITE) hearing aids are custom-made to fit your ear canal and are suitable for mild to severe hearing loss.
- Behind-the-ear (BTE) hearing aids are versatile and can accommodate various levels of hearing loss.
- Receiver-in-canal (RIC) hearing aids are similar to BTE but have a smaller casing that sits behind the ear.
- Completely-in-canal (CIC) hearing aids are discreet and fit entirely in the ear canal, suitable for mild to moderate hearing loss.
- In-the-canal (ITC) hearing aids are slightly larger than CIC but still offer a discreet option for mild to moderate hearing loss.
Each type has its own advantages, so consider your lifestyle and hearing needs when choosing the right affordable hearing aid for you.
Features to Consider
Consideration of key features plays a crucial role in selecting the most suitable affordable hearing aid for your needs. When choosing a hearing aid, look for features that cater to your specific requirements.
One important feature to consider is the amplification settings. Ensure the hearing aid offers adjustable amplification levels to accommodate different environments and hearing situations. Additionally, feedback cancellation is vital to prevent annoying whistling sounds that can occur with some devices.
Another essential feature is noise reduction technology, which helps filter out background noise, allowing you to focus on conversations or important sounds. Comfort is key, so opt for hearing aids with a comfortable fit and customizable ear tips. Some models also offer Bluetooth connectivity, enabling you to stream audio directly from your phone or other devices.
Lastly, consider the battery life of the hearing aid. Look for a device with long-lasting batteries or rechargeable options to avoid frequent replacements. By carefully evaluating these features, you can find an affordable hearing aid that best suits your lifestyle and hearing needs.

Where to Buy Hearing Aids
If you’re in the market for hearing aids and are wondering where to purchase them, various options are available to suit your needs. One common option is to buy hearing aids from audiologists or hearing aid specialists. These professionals can assess your hearing needs and recommend the most suitable devices for you.
Another popular choice is purchasing hearing aids from online retailers. Online platforms offer a wide range of brands and models at different price points, allowing you to compare options conveniently from the comfort of your own home.
You can also consider buying hearing aids from big-box stores or pharmacy chains that offer hearing aid services. These stores often have dedicated sections for hearing aids and may provide hearing tests and fittings on-site.
Additionally, some hearing aid manufacturers sell directly to consumers through their websites or authorized dealers. This option can be beneficial if you prefer a specific brand or model. Ultimately, the best place to buy hearing aids will depend on your preferences, budget, and individual hearing needs.

How Often Should I Have My Hearing Aids Professionally Cleaned?
You should have your hearing aids professionally cleaned every 3 to 6 months. Regular maintenance ensures optimal performance and longevity. Cleaning by a professional helps prevent wax buildup and maintains the quality of sound output.
